About this experience

Discover the scenic beauty and flavours of the Derwent & Coal River Valley's, sample amazing wines from these 2 regions. Join us as we stroll through beautiful vineyards and learn about the local grape varieties and rich history of the areas. On this small group tour, we will visit 4 different vineyards and enjoy samples of some of the region’s best wines. Round-trip transportation lets you sip without worry. Depending on the day of your tour, the order in which we visit the venues will depend on availability, weather and other determining factors. We may need to substitute a venue for another similar venue.

What you'll see and do

  1. Derwent Estate

    The day will start with a drive to a local family-owned vineyard to begin your introduction to the wines of the region.

    60 minutes here · Admission included

  2. Depending on the day of your tour, the vineyards which we visit will depend on availability, weather and other determining factors.

    45 minutes here · Admission included

  3. Lunch Stop - Cost not included in tour cost Average cost is $30.00

    60 minutes here · Admission not included

  4. We will visit beautiful historic Richmond and Australia's oldest bridge.

    30 minutes here · Admission included

  5. Pooley Wines

    Through the day we will visit an additional 3-4 handpicked small & unique vineyards where you will experience a tasting & learn about the wines they produce.

    50 minutes here · Admission included

  6. The Wicked Cheese Co.

    We will stop for a cheese tasting at the Wicked Cheese Co.

    20 minutes here · Admission included

  7. Puddleduck Wines

    Join us as we stroll through beautiful vineyards and learn about the local grape varieties and rich history of the area.

    45 minutes here · Admission included
